    Oh good grief. Why do we have to do this again? It's simple:

    Boat dry weight: 5900 pounds
    Fuel: 65 gallon at 7 pounds/gallon: 455 pounds
    Boards, cooler, etc.: 200 pounds
    Trailer: 1200 pounds

    Total: 7755 pounds

    And because you never want to be right at the limit, you need a tow rig capable of pulling 8500 pounds minimum and it needs to be properly wired for the trailer brakes.
